Designing Woman

Designing Woman

Screen legends Gregory Peck ("To Kill a Mockingbird," "Gentleman's Agreement") and Lauren Bacall ("The Big Sleep," "Murder on the Orient Express") respectively portray a sports writer and a fashion designer who marry and come to realize they have nothing in common. Winner of an Academy Award for Best Original Screenplay, this acclaimed comedy offers a hilarious look at the institution of marriage. Directed by Oscar-winner Vincente Minnelli ("Gigi," "An American in Paris"). With TV's frustrated Maytag repairman, Jesse White, and Chuck Connors (TV's "The Rifleman").

The Fearless Vampire Killers

The Fearless Vampire Killers

Clever comedy-horror film directed by Roman Polanski. An expert on bats, Professor Abronsius and his dim-witted assistant, Alfred, travel to Transylvania to try to find and destroy vampires. Alfred falls for the vampire's latest target - the inn-keeper's daughter. Also known as Dance of the Vampires and Pardon Me, But Your Teeth Are In My Neck.

Heroes (1977)

Heroes (1977)

Two unlikely companions find themselves when they find each other in this heart-warming drama starring Henry Winkler and Sally Field. Years after his return from the Vietnam War, traumatized former soldier Jack Dunne (Winkler) still has nightmares about his experience. During a cross-country bus ride to California, he meets Carol (Field) and tells her of his plans to open a worm farm with some of his fellow comrades. But as his buddies drop out of the project one by one, it’s soon clear that only Carol can give the shattered man hope for a brighter future. Co-starring Harrison Ford, it’s a deeply moving and thoughtful story you won’t soon forget.

Uncle Buck

Uncle Buck

John Candy stars in this John Hughes comedy as an idle, good-natured bachelor who's left in charge of his nephew and nieces during a family crisis. Unaccustomed to suburban life, fun-loving Uncle Buck soon charms his younger relatives Miles and Maizy with his hefty cooking and his new way of doing the laundry. But his carefree style doesn't impress everyone, including Tia (Jean Kelly), his rebellious teenage niece, and Chanice (Amy Madigan), his impatient girlfriend. Uncle Buck is the last person you'd think of to watch the kids. But with a little luck and a lot of love, he manages to surprise everyone in this heartwarming family comedy.
